[media] ati_remote: allow specifying a default keymap selector function



Currently the ati_remote default keymap is selected directly based on
the USB device id.

Add support for instead specifying a function returning the default
keymap, allowing more complex selection logic to be added when needed.

This will be used for Medion X10 remotes in a following commit.
